Sunnycrest, Chandler, AZ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Sunnycrest?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sunnycrest 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,008 | $995 | $3,200 |
| Sunnycrest 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,337 | $2,095 | $2,500 |
| Sunnycrest 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,873 | $2,550 | $3,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sunnycrest
What type of rentals are currently available in Sunnycrest?
There are currently 77 Apartments for Rent in Sunnycrest, AZ with pricing that ranges from $1,300 to $6,079. There are also 19 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Sunnycrest ranging from $995 to $3,400.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Sunnycrest?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Sunnycrest ranges from $995 to $3,400 with an average monthly rent of $2,160.
